- [ ] **Step 7: Breaker override escrow.** After sealing the signing keys for the Tallgrove upstream API circuit breaker, confirm the support team can force the breaker open during a full outage. The override bundle lives in the sealed escrow drawer and is useless without its unlock phrase. Two ceremony witnesses must initial this step before proceeding. The escrow bundle is decrypted with the recovery passphrase that follows.

vault phrase of kahip-kahop = holath-quenmir

## Tuning

Quillpress render latency is dominated by partial compilation, not I/O. If a customer reports slow pages, check cache hit rate first; below 90% means the template cache is too small or churn is too high. Bump cache size before touching worker counts. Raising workers past core count just adds contention. Do not change eviction mode without engineering sign-off. All knobs live in one place and ship with these defaults:

constants for hahof-bajep:
THRESHOLDS = {
    "sorwyn": 797,
    "jorath": 933,
    "pramir": 998,
    "wenath": 950,
    "silok": 489,
    "prawyn": 572,
    "praiel": 821,
}

Hey Marit,

Quick handover before I'm out next week: the Pellwick metrics-aggregation sidecar (v2.4) is staged for Thursday's release train. Flush intervals are already tuned, so don't touch the config unless the Quarrel dashboard screams. Rollback is the usual helm revert. You'll need to sign the bundle before pushing to the Tindervale registry; use the key below.

release key, fajef-kajeg: bky19_LdLu6Ne6FLi8he2c24d